A guest starts from a restaurant link or permanent QR. Menu browsing, language choice, service mode, safety information, and the accessible list do not require a MenuFaro account.
Public route; no restaurant-team permission is required.Scan the restaurant’s permanent QR or open its published restaurant and location link. If you are only exploring MenuFaro, use the sample library.
A QR stores an opaque stable token, not a release, tenant, asset, or language. The same printed code can resolve a later reviewed release.Browse public menu samplesChoose a published language and the restaurant’s available dine-in, takeaway, or delivery view. Prices can differ by service mode.
A language or mode choice changes presentation only. It does not create an order, payment, reservation, or food-safety guarantee.No action is required from this guideOpen dish details and read confirmed allergen and cross-contact wording. Ask the restaurant directly when the information is uncertain or your health depends on it.
MenuFaro never calls a dish safe or allergen-free because a filter, absence value, or AI suggestion says so.No action is required from this guideIn Fullscreen Swipe Menu, use swipe, scroll, Previous and Next, or switch to the normal list. Gestures are never the only route.
The public experience keeps keyboard focus visible, respects reduced motion, and exposes dish content in a readable sequence.Open the public menu exampleRetry after your connection returns. The current service worker is network-only and does not cache private workspaces or pretend that an old response is current.
A complete last-published-menu offline cache is still a target-track feature. The current web slice provides honest connection recovery instead.Open connection recovery helpUse the Privacy Center to clear supported local preferences and understand which organization controls a request.
A guest can contact the privacy route without signing in. MenuFaro does not claim a request is complete merely because it was sent.Open the Privacy CenterShared release model
The website and installed web app use the same release contract. A visual preview is never the live menu.
Dish, price, media, theme, translation, availability, tax/service, and safety changes remain private.
Resolve permission, plan, content, media, language, commercial-policy, allergen, and QR blockers.
Only an authorized owner or manager confirms the exact revision and fingerprint. Success waits for durable readback.
The stable token resolves the current immutable release. Republishing does not require reprinting the code.
